Hiking around Noblejas offers access to the agricultural landscapes and vast plains characteristic of the Toledo province in Castilla-La Mancha. The region features local routes that traverse open countryside, often showcasing vineyards and traditional Spanish rural scenery. While Noblejas itself provides accessible trails, its location allows for exploration of the wider natural beauty, including areas with Mediterranean forest ecosystems. The terrain generally consists of gentle gradients, making many routes suitable for various activity levels.

The Plaza Mayor of Ocaña (Toledo) is considered one of the most impressive in Castilla-La Mancha due to its size, harmony, and historical significance. It is an arcaded square in the Baroque and Neoclassical styles, begun in 1777 by order of Charles III to emulate the Plaza Mayor of Madrid, albeit on a smaller scale. Its dimensions are imposing: 55 x 52 meters, almost square, with 70 stone pillars and semicircular arches supporting balconies and dormer windows. Symmetry and proportion are highly valued, creating an elegant and monumental visual effect.

Chinchón is located in the southeast of the Community of Madrid, nestled between the Tajuña and Tajo rivers. It is one of the most visited towns in Madrid; in fact, it appears on the list of the most beautiful towns in Spain. It was also one of the candidate towns to be the Capital of Rural Tourism in 2022. The most visited area is its Plaza Mayor, a porticoed square from the 15th and 16th centuries. Other highlights include the Castle of the Counts of Chinchón, the Lope de Vega Theater, the Clock Tower, the Convent of the Poor Clares, the five hermitages of San Antón, San Roque, Santa Ana, and those of Nuestra Señora del Rosario and Nuestra Señora de la Misericordia.

A small town near Madrid that is worth visiting to stroll through its streets and enjoy its typical cuisine. Its main attraction is its Plaza Mayor, an example of the architecture of Castilian porticoed squares - with 234 balconies - and where most of the restaurants are concentrated. But it is worth strolling through its streets, going up to see the Church of Nuestra Señora de la Asunción, where we can see Goya's painting "The Assumption of the Virgin". In addition, in front of the church there is a viewing point from which there are excellent views of the Plaza Mayor and the entire town. There is also the Clock Tower and the Lope de Vega Theatre, all just a few metres away. Other places of interest are the Parador de Chinchón, a former Augustinian convent; the Castle of the Counts of Chinchón, the Casa de la Cadena, the hermitages of San Antón and San Roque.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many hiking trails are available around Noblejas?

There are over 25 hiking routes documented around Noblejas, offering a variety of experiences. These include 8 easy trails and 17 moderate options, ensuring there's something for different fitness levels.

Are there any easy hiking trails suitable for beginners or families?

Yes, Noblejas offers several easy trails perfect for beginners or families. For instance, the Ocana - circular tour of the historic center is an easy 4.9 km path that explores Ocaña's historic core. Another accessible option is the Fountain of Hercules and Antaeus – Royal Palace of Aranjuez loop, an easy 7 km route.

What kind of landscapes can I expect to see while hiking near Noblejas?

Hiking around Noblejas primarily features the agricultural landscapes and vast plains characteristic of the Toledo province in Castilla-La Mancha. You'll often traverse open countryside, showcasing vineyards and traditional Spanish rural scenery. The terrain generally consists of gentle gradients, making for pleasant walks.

Are there any circular hiking routes in the Noblejas area?

Yes, several circular routes are available. The Ocana - circular tour of the historic center is an easy loop, and the Chinchón – Historic Center of Chinchón loop from Colmenar de Oreja offers a longer, moderate circular experience through rural landscapes and historic towns.

What natural landmarks or points of interest can I explore on hikes around Noblejas?

The region offers several natural highlights. You can visit the Laguna Seca de las Esteras or the Laguna de Noblejas. Other points of interest include the Fuente de la Pajarita and the Villacabras Spring, which are notable natural monuments.

Are there any historical sites or cultural attractions accessible via hiking trails?

Yes, the area around Noblejas has historical significance. The local Cueva Villacampa, for example, is a Roman mine of 'lapis specularis' offering a blend of natural exploration and historical intrigue. You can also explore the historic core of Ocaña with the Ocana - circular tour, or visit the Plaza Mayor of Colmenar de Oreja.

Can I find longer, more challenging hikes near Noblejas?

While Noblejas itself offers mostly easy to moderate trails, its location allows for exploration of more extensive natural areas. For longer, more challenging options, consider a day trip to Cabañeros National Park in the Montes de Toledo, known for its diverse hiking routes and Mediterranean forest ecosystems.

Is Noblejas a good base for exploring other natural areas in the Toledo province?

Absolutely. Noblejas serves as a convenient starting point for exploring the wider natural beauty of the Toledo province. Beyond local trails, you can easily access significant areas like Cabañeros National Park, a prime destination for outdoor activities, or sections of the Tajo Natural Path for long-distance hiking.

Are there any routes that connect Noblejas to nearby towns?

Yes, some routes, often suitable for both hiking and mountain biking, connect Noblejas with neighboring areas. For example, there are routes extending towards Aranjuez and Ontígola, or to Villarrubia de Santiago, offering a chance to explore the broader region and its agricultural landscapes.

What is the typical terrain like on the hiking trails around Noblejas?

The terrain around Noblejas is generally characterized by open, agricultural plains and countryside. You can expect mostly flat or gently rolling paths, often unpaved tracks through fields and vineyards. This makes for relatively easy walking conditions, though some routes may have short, moderate ascents.
